AP United States History spans from pre-Columbian America through the present day, organized into nine thematic learning objectives. The course emphasizes major periods like colonization, the American Revolution, westward expansion, the Civil War and Reconstruction, industrialization, progressive era reforms, America's rise as a world power, and modern social movements. A tutor can help you master the historical narratives, key documents, and cause-and-effect relationships that the exam tests, ensuring you understand not just the facts but the broader historical themes that connect different time periods.

The AP exam consists of two sections: a multiple-choice and short-answer section (95 minutes) and a free-response section with document-based questions and long essays (100 minutes). The multiple-choice questions test your ability to identify historical concepts and analyze primary sources, while the free-response section requires you to construct arguments using evidence. Personalized tutoring can help you develop strategies for each section—like how to quickly analyze documents under pressure and organize your essays to maximize points.

Students often struggle with three main areas: managing the sheer volume of content across 400+ years of history, analyzing primary sources quickly during the exam, and constructing evidence-based arguments rather than simply listing facts. Many also find it difficult to see connections between different historical periods or to understand causation versus correlation. A tutor can help you develop a study system that prioritizes the most heavily tested topics, teaches you to read sources strategically, and coaches you on how to write responses that earn full credit by directly addressing the prompt with specific evidence.

Practice tests are essential for AP United States History success because they help you understand the exam's pacing, question patterns, and scoring rubrics. Taking full-length practice exams under timed conditions reveals which content areas you need to review and which question types give you the most trouble. A tutor can review your practice test results with you, identify patterns in your mistakes, and help you adjust your study strategy accordingly—whether that means spending more time on a particular era, improving your document analysis skills, or refining your essay structure.

Most students benefit from starting AP United States History preparation 8-12 weeks before the exam if they're already in the course, or longer if they're reviewing material from a previous year. A realistic study schedule includes reviewing one major historical period per week, taking practice tests every 2-3 weeks, and focusing your final weeks on weak areas and test-taking strategies.
